Leaving school may seem a long way ahead, however, the decisions you make now may affect future options and what you can go on to do later. Consequently, the choices you make are important, so please give them plenty of thought and consideration.
Our advice is to read through this website carefully, making sure you understand the differences between the various choices available. Ask questions and discuss your options but do remember that:
you are more likely to achieve well in a subject that you are interested in
you are more likely to be motivated to work hard in a subject you enjoy
your chosen subjects need to suit your particular strengths
you need to consider the impact your subject choices might have on your long-term aims such as post-16 courses, university, college, apprenticeships, training schemes and future employment.

In summary, you need to select three option subjects. Language is compulsory for the vast majority of students. All students also take RE. Students will be allocated by the school to either the Combined Science or Separate Science course.
